BWW Review: MAYERLING, Royal Opera House

BWW Review: MAYERLING, Royal Opera House

by Vikki Jane Vile — June 13, 2020

Kenneth MacMillan's Mayerling is the vivid dramatisation of the life of Crown Prince Rudolph and his death alongside his young mistress Mary Vetsera in 1889.

BLEED Ten-Week Digital Festival Announced

BLEED Ten-Week Digital Festival Announced

by A.A. Cristi — June 4, 2020

BLEED (Biennial Live Event in the Everyday Digital) is a new ten-week digital festival presented away from gatherings in auditoriums and conceived pre-COVID-19 by Arts House (Melbourne) and Campbelltown Arts Centre (Sydney).
